Trump targets DC crime; homicide-free for 12 days

Arrests under President Donald Trump’s federal crime crackdown in Washington, D.C., topped 1,000 on Monday. The city is also marking its 12th consecutive day without a homicide as the White House rolled out new executive orders targeting local crime and bail reform.
